.DataSheet.co.kr HT7L2102 Anti-EMI, High Efficiency Dimmable LED Lighting Driver with Green Mode and Integrated Protections Feature - Frequency Jitter for EMI Restriction - Integrated Soft-Start Function - Very Low Operating Current and Start-up Current (<20mA) for satisfying Energy-Star 2.0 "No-Load Mode" (Stand-by) Power standard - ±5% Trimmed Oscillator for Precise Frequency - Non-Audible-Noise Green Mode Control to maintain efficiency for both Light and Heavy Loads - LEB (Leading-Edge Blanking) on CS Pin - Internal Slope pensation - Cycle-by-Cycle Current Limiting - Short-Circuit-Protection(SCP) for Short-Circuit and Over-Load Condition - Over-Voltage-Protection(OVP) on VCC Pin - Over-Temperature-Protection(OTP) on TS pin for External Thermistor Sensing - 1~99% PWM Dimming Range - 8-pin SOP package General Description The HT7L2102 is an advanced, highly integrated LED Lighting driver using an AC-DC isolation topology. The device provides many protection functions and uses ultra low power circuit design, and is optimized to restrict EMI. By integrating a Non-Audible Noise Green Mode Control Structure, users can implement a single circuit for different LED load levels for various series/parallel configurations but still maintain high efficiency for different load conditions. This device also integrates various protection functions for LED Lighting requirements such as Cycle-by-Cycle Current Limiting, Short-Circuit Protection (SCP), Over-Voltage Protection (OVP), Over-Temperature Protection (OTP) for external thermistor sensing, and a Soft-Start function to reduce inrush currents during LED power system initialization for the prevention of device burn-out.
